Transaction 12532a054d91fcf746930e5e651a62c598a2fa4b6d88f3c8a29761d885aa4872

1 Input
2 Outputs
  • 12532a054d91fcf746930e5e651a62c598a2fa4b6d88f3c8a29761d885aa4872:0
  • value  54551861
    address  16aJD2ayGP3D2uKrB6ghyt7DT972Nzv564
  • 12532a054d91fcf746930e5e651a62c598a2fa4b6d88f3c8a29761d885aa4872:1
  • value  29820000
    address  39CVWyCoXWoABMVzaB3BwNmXcCNkkyZ2nb